Electrical Safety for Battery Energy Storage Systems (BESS)
Ground fault monitoring on Battery Energy Storage Systems is vital to maintain a safe installation and maximize up-time. Bender''s IMD EV technology and insulation monitoring devices provide early detection of insulation faults in battery energy storage systems, preventing potential hazards like Li-Ion fires. UL 9540:2020 Section 14.8
NFPA 855
- Ventilation and Detection •Exhaust Ventilation —1ft3/min/ft2 —Designed to keep flammable gasses under 25% of LFL —Exhaust away from openings •Smoke and Fire Detection —Gas detection activates ventilation —Smoke detection per NFPA 72 14 4.9 4.10

2019 California Residential Code section R327.7 for Heat
California Residential Code section R327.7 for Heat Detection for Energy Storage Systems . The 2019 Intervening Code Cycle adopted the 2021 International Code Council''s regulations for Energy Storage Systems (ESS) which included a requirement for a residential heat detector that that does not exist. Fire Codes and NFPA 855 for Energy Storage Systems
The ESS project that led to the first edition of NFPA 855, the Standard for the Installation of Stationary Energy Storage Systems (released in 2019), originated from a request submitted on behalf of the California Energy Storage Alliance. Informational Bulletin For Residential Energy Storage
There are other requirements in IRC Section R328 that are not within the scope of this bulletin. ESS Product Listing 2021 IRC Section R328.2 states: "Energy storage systems (ESS) shall be listed and labeled in accordance with UL 9540." UL 9540-16 is the product safety standard for Energy Storage Systems and Equipment
Battery Energy Storage Fire Protection Solutions
Everon''s energy storage experts can help install radiometric thermal imaging devices that continuously monitor the temperature in and around your energy storage systems. Off-Gas Detection Off-gas detection technologies can provide an alert in the initial stage of lithium-ion battery failure when venting of electrolyte solvent vapors begins

Residential Energy Storage System Regulations
It makes sense that these types of energy storage systems are only permitted to be installed outdoors. One last location requirement has to do with vehicle impact. One way that an energy storage system can overheat and lead to a fire or explosion is if the unit itself is physically damaged by being crushed or impacted.

What are the guidelines for battery management systems in energy storage applications?
Guidelines under development include IEEE P2686 “Recommended Practice for Battery Management Systems in Energy Storage Applications” (set for balloting in 2022). This recommended practice includes information on the design, installation, and configuration of battery management systems (BMSs) in stationary applications.
What is storage fire detection?
SEAC’s Storage Fire Detection working group strives to clarify the fire detection requirements in the International Codes (I-Codes). The 2021 IRC calls for the installation of heat detectors that are interconnected to smoke alarms. The problem is detectors and alarms are different systems that cannot be interconnected with one another.
